Company description:

NFU Mutual is a leading provider of general insurance and financial services. From our strong farming roots we’ve grown to become a UK-wide organisation, turning over £1billion annually. Yet success hasn’t gone to our heads. We’re proud to remain completely customer focused, down-to-earth and committed to the rural communities we’ve grown from. OUR HISTORY Founded in 1910, our aim was to encourage farmers around Stratford-upon-Avon into the newly established farming union through cost price insurance. Today we offer an advice-rich proposition to both farming and non-farming customers. While we continue to support the farming community and remain an integral part of the British countryside, we offer an extensive range of personal and commercial covers, as well as investments and pensions, to a wide range of customers.
